Sesame spinach
Blanch, squeeze, dress. Gomae logic. The squeeze is the whole recipe.

What it needs
Nothing confirmed on your shelf yet — this list is the whole ask.
- spinach
- sesame oil
- soy sauce
- sesame seeds
Good if you have them, fine if you do not: garlic.
Method
- Blanch the spinach thirty seconds and shock it in cold water, then squeeze it dry in your hands.
- That squeeze is the whole technique. Unsqueezed spinach makes a watery, diluted side.
- Dress it cold with sesame oil, soy and garlic, separating the squeezed clump with your fingers.
- Toasted sesame seeds crushed slightly so they release their oil. Served at room temperature.

Why each of these is on the list
What the ingredients are actually doing
- spinach
- Volume that vanishes. A pan-filling pile cooks down to a few spoonfuls, and the water it gives up will dilute whatever it lands in unless you wring it out first.
- sesame oil
- A seasoning, not a cooking oil.
- soy sauce
- Salt with a savory backbone, so it seasons and deepens in one move.
- sesame seeds
- Nothing much until they are toasted, then nutty and fragrant.
